Internal Article: BigCommerce Data Connection
In order to set up your BigCommerce Data Feed, we will need you to create an API Account for us. This can only be done by the Store Owner.

When logged in to BigCommerce as the Store Owner user, please follow the directions below:
- Go to "Settings" in the BigCommerce Admin area
- In the "API" section select "Store-level API accounts".
- Click the "Create API Account" button and select "Create V2/V3 API Token"
- For the Name field, enter "Searchspring"
- For the OAuth Scopes, select:
- Content: read-only
- Products: read-only
- Theme: read-only
- Customers: read-only (required for Personalization)
- Orders: read-only (required for Personalization)
- Channel Listings: read-only (required for Multi-Storefront)
-
Channel Settings: read-only (required for Multi-Storefront)
- Everything else: None
- Click Save at the page's lower right-hand corner
After Saving, this will automatically Download a .txt file to your computer. Send this .txt file back to your Searchspring contact and we will reach out again should any issues arise with the data connection.
There will not be a separate button to click for the file Download; this download will happen automatically. Check the "Downloads" folder on your computer after Saving the API Account.

BigCommerce Multi-Storefront
If your BigCommerce store is set up to use Multi-Storefront, you are able to select the storefront you would like to use as the Data Feed.
